Understanding the Exchange Rate: USD to OMR

The cornerstone of any currency exchange is the exchange rate. This simply represents the value of one currency relative to another. Which means, the exact amount you receive for 100 USD in OMR will vary depending on the prevailing exchange rate at the time of conversion. The rate fluctuates constantly based on various economic factors (discussed later). You won't get a fixed amount; it's dynamic.

To find the current exchange rate, you can use online converters, check with your bank or financial institution, or consult a currency exchange service. These sources typically display the rate as a ratio, for example, 1 USD = 0.Think about it: 385 OMR (this is an example and not a guaranteed current rate). Day to day, this means that one US dollar is equal to approximately 0. 385 Omani Rials.

To calculate the approximate OMR equivalent of 100 USD, you would multiply 100 by the current exchange rate. Using our example rate: 100 USD * 0.That said, 385 OMR/USD ≈ 38. 5 OMR. Remember, this is just an illustration; you should always check the current exchange rate before making any transactions.

Methods for Converting 100 USD to OMR

Several methods exist for converting your 100 USD to Omani Rial, each with its own advantages and disadvantages:

  • Banks: Banks often offer currency exchange services, typically providing competitive rates, especially for larger amounts. That said, they might charge fees or commissions. The convenience and perceived security are often major advantages.

  • Currency Exchange Bureaus: These specialized businesses provide currency exchange services and often offer competitive rates. They can be a convenient option, particularly in tourist areas. Even so, it is essential to compare rates across multiple bureaus to find the best deal and be mindful of potential hidden fees.

  • Airport Exchange: Airports offer currency exchange, but they often charge higher fees and offer less favorable rates due to their captive audience. This is generally the least advantageous method, unless it is a matter of extreme urgency.

  • Online Currency Exchange: Several online platforms allow you to exchange currency electronically. These can sometimes offer competitive rates and convenience, but always verify the legitimacy and security of the platform before using their services. This option is generally suited for larger transactions.

  • Travel Money Cards: Pre-loaded travel money cards are a safe and convenient option, particularly for tourists. These cards allow you to load money in one currency and spend it in another, at rates that are typically pre-determined.

Factors Influencing the USD to OMR Exchange Rate

Several factors contribute to the constant fluctuation in the USD to OMR exchange rate:

  • Economic Conditions: The economic health of both the United States and Oman plays a significant role. Factors such as inflation, interest rates, GDP growth, and political stability in both countries influence the value of their respective currencies.

  • Global Events: Major global events, such as political instability, natural disasters, or international conflicts, can impact exchange rates. Uncertainty in the global market creates volatility.

  • Supply and Demand: The exchange rate is influenced by the supply and demand for each currency. If more people are exchanging USD for OMR, the demand for OMR increases, potentially pushing up its value relative to the USD.

  • Central Bank Policies: The monetary policies of the US Federal Reserve and the Central Bank of Oman impact their respective currencies. Changes in interest rates or other policy decisions can cause significant shifts in the exchange rate.

  • Speculation: Currency traders and investors often speculate on future exchange rate movements, which can influence the current rate. Their actions based on predictions can create short-term volatility.

Tips for Maximizing Your Money When Exchanging USD to OMR

To get the most out of your 100 USD, consider these tips:

  • Compare Exchange Rates: Before exchanging your money, compare rates from different banks, bureaus, and online services. Use multiple sources and look for the best possible deal.

  • Be Aware of Fees: Be mindful of any fees or commissions charged by the exchange service. These fees can significantly eat into your overall return. Look for services with transparent fee structures.

  • Exchange Larger Amounts: Exchange bureaus often offer more favorable rates for larger sums of money. If you can, combine your exchange with others to increase the total amount.

  • Check for Hidden Charges: Pay close attention to the exchange rate quoted, but also look for hidden charges or commissions. Some providers may advertise a competitive rate but then add significant additional fees.

  • Use a Reputable Exchange Service: Choose a reputable and trustworthy bank or exchange bureau to avoid scams or fraud. Use well-established institutions to minimise risks.

  • Time Your Exchange: Consider the timing of your exchange. Significant news or events can trigger sudden fluctuations in the exchange rate. Monitoring the rate closely before your exchange can help you secure a better deal.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

  • Q: Can I exchange USD to OMR at an ATM?

    • A: While some ATMs might offer currency exchange, it's generally not recommended due to potentially unfavorable exchange rates and high fees.
  • Q: Are there any restrictions on exchanging USD to OMR?

    • A: Generally, there are no significant restrictions for exchanging USD to OMR for personal use, but larger transactions might require additional documentation. Check with the relevant authorities for any specific regulations.
  • Q: What is the best time to exchange currency?

    • A: The best time to exchange currency is when the exchange rate is most favorable. This is affected by fluctuating market forces, and there's no definitive 'best' time, but it requires some market monitoring.
  • Q: What if the exchange rate changes after I've agreed to the exchange?

    • A: Reputable exchange services will typically honor the agreed-upon rate at the time of the transaction, unless there are unforeseen extreme circumstances. Always clarify this point before finalizing the exchange.
  • Q: Can I exchange USD to OMR online?

    • A: Yes, some online services allow for USD to OMR exchange. Be extremely cautious, however, in selecting a trusted and reputable platform to avoid scams and fraudulent activities.
